Whalebone Golf Club was created from a belief that golf should feel open, welcoming and relevant to modern communities -...
04/06/2026

Whalebone Golf Club was created from a belief that golf should feel open, welcoming and relevant to modern communities - particularly younger audiences and people who may previously have felt excluded from the sport.

The rebrand to Whalebone Golf Club reflects a wider shift away from traditional barriers towards a more inclusive, community-led experience.

The thinking behind our new “Club Code” was simple: remove the friction that stops people from trying golf in the first place. This includes everything from dress codes and perceived etiquette barriers to affordability and making the environment feel social rather than intimidating.

The club wanted to create a place where someone could come for their first-ever swing, play casually with friends, practice a game they love seriously, or bring their family - all without feeling judged or out of place.

The philosophy became: “Play as you are.”

George Lings, PGA Golf Professional and head of Coaching at Whalebone Golf Club says: “Kids and beginners don’t fall in love with golf because someone lectures them on etiquette on day one - they fall in love with it because they have fun. Our whole approach is about making people feel relaxed, welcome and excited to come back. If someone leaves smiling and wanting another go, that’s a win for us.”

Whalebone is 18 holes of proper inland links golf — 4,293 yards, par 64, USGA-spec fairways that play fast and true what...
24/05/2026

Whalebone is 18 holes of proper inland links golf — 4,293 yards, par 64, USGA-spec fairways that play fast and true whatever the season. Designed by Bruce Weller, it’s a course with real character: a 16th hole that’ll make your palms sweat (water left, bunker right, nowhere to hide) and an 18th that sends you home with either a fist pump or a story.

You can get round it quickly and under two hours if you’re sharp. Come as you are, dress as you please and after 4pm, children play for free — which means the only thing stopping you bringing the whole family is whether you trust your short game in front of a tough crowd.
